编程是什么水平可以接私活

fiy 其他 140

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    接私活的编程水平要求是能够独立完成一定难度的项目,并且有一定的开发经验和技术能力。具体来说,以下几个方面是评估接私活编程水平的重要指标:

    1. 编程语言掌握程度:能够熟练地使用一种或多种编程语言进行开发,包括语法、数据结构、算法等。至少要精通一门主流编程语言,如Java、Python、C++等。

    2. 开发工具及框架的熟练度:熟悉并能够熟练使用各种开发工具和框架,例如IDE(集成开发环境)、版本控制工具(如Git)、前端开发框架(如React、Angular)等。

    3. 数据库和SQL语言的使用:具备数据库的设计和开发能力,能够使用SQL语言进行数据库的操作和优化。对于大型数据量、高并发的项目,对数据库的性能优化能力是必不可少的。

    4. 前端开发和UI设计:具备一定的前端开发知识和技能,能够根据需求进行页面的设计和实现,熟悉HTML、CSS、JavaScript等前端开发技术。

    5. 系统架构设计能力:具备一定的系统架构设计能力,能够根据项目需求,设计合适的架构模式,并保证系统的性能、可靠性、可扩展性等。

    6. 项目管理和团队协作能力:有一定的项目管理和团队协作经验,能够独立完成项目的需求分析、任务分配和进度控制,并与团队成员协作完成项目。

    总的来说,接私活的编程水平要求是具备一定的编码能力、开发经验和技术广度,能够独立解决问题并完成项目。对于不同类型的私活,可能有不同的技术要求,因此还需要根据具体需求来评估编程水平是否符合要求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程能力的水平可以根据以下几个方面来评估是否可以接私活:

    1. 编程语言掌握程度:具备扎实的编程语言基础是接私活的基本要求。可以根据市场需求选择熟练掌握的编程语言,如Python、Java、C++等。掌握多种编程语言可以提供更多的接单机会。

    2. 算法和数据结构:掌握常见的算法和数据结构是编程能力的基础。了解常见的排序、查找、遍历等算法,并能够应用合适的数据结构解决实际问题。

    3. 框架和工具的使用:熟悉常用的开发框架和工具可以提高开发效率,例如Web开发中的Spring、Django,移动应用开发中的React Native、Flutter等。具备一定的框架和工具使用经验可以接受更复杂的私活项目。

    4. 项目经验:具备一定的项目经验能够更好地理解和应对客户需求。通过参与开源项目或者个人项目的开发,可以积累项目经验,并展示自己的能力。

    5. 沟通与团队合作能力:接私活需要与客户沟通需求,理解客户的业务场景,并与团队成员协作完成项目。因此,良好的沟通能力和团队合作精神同样重要。

    总之,接私活的能力水平需要具备一定的编程基础、算法与数据结构知识、框架与工具的使用经验,同时具备良好的沟通与团队合作能力。不同的私活项目对技术水平的要求不同,可以根据自身情况选择适合自己的项目。在实践中不断学习和提升自己的编程能力,才能更好地接私活并获得成功。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    接私活的水平要求因人而异,但一般来说,以下是一些参考指标:

    1. 熟练掌握一种编程语言:要接私活,首先需要在至少一种编程语言上有较为扎实的掌握。这包括了语法、常用的编程概念、数据结构与算法等。对于初级私活来说,通常掌握一种主流编程语言就足够了,例如Python、Java、C#等。

    2. 熟悉常用的开发工具和框架:在实际项目开发中,常用的开发工具和框架能够提高开发效率。对于接私活来说,可以根据具体需求和项目选择工具和框架。例如,Web开发中常见的工具和框架有Spring、Django、Flask等,移动端开发中常见的工具和框架有React Native、Flutter等。

    3. 具备基本的项目经验:具备一定的项目经验可以帮助你更好地处理私活。这包括了项目需求分析、任务拆分、与客户沟通等。可以通过参加线上或线下的实战项目、自己开发小项目等来积累经验。

    4. 掌握合作与沟通技巧:接私活需要与客户进行有效的沟通,了解需求并与客户保持良好的合作关系。学会询问问题、解决问题和与客户进行良好的沟通是非常重要的。

    除了以上要求,还有一些其他的技能可以提高你接私活的能力,例如版本控制、测试和调试技巧、团队协作等。总之,接私活的水平要求是一个渐进的过程,通过实践和持续学习,逐步提高自己的技术能力和项目经验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部